(AdonisJs 4.0 Tutorial) 관리자 삭제하기


  • xyz/Controllers/Http/Mgmt/AdminController.js 에 다음을 추가한다.
    ...
     
      // 관리자 삭제
      // /mgmt/admin/delete/:id
      async delete ({params, response}) {
        const admin = await Admin.find(params.id)
        await admin.delete()
        return response.route('mgmt_admin')
      }
     
    ...
  • xyz/start/routes.js 에 다음을 추가하고, 관리자 삭제를 해봅니다.
      Route.get('/admin/delete/:id', 'Mgmt/AdminController.delete').as('mgmt_admin_delete')
  • 여기까지 하면, 기본적인 CRUD 기능을 모두 작성할 수 있게 됩니다. *^^*

댓글

이 블로그의 인기 게시물

야마하 디지털 피아노 YDP-140

테이블위로 마우스 커서 이동시 색깔 변경하기

피아노 연습